Las Cabras Beach, located in Fuencaliente de la Palma, Canary Islands, Spain, is a serene and isolated cove nestled within the rugged coastline of the Cumbre Vieja and Teneguia Nature Park. The beach features dark sand and is surrounded by a natural environment, making it perfect for those seeking a tranquil retreat. The moderate waves and small size of the beach create a peaceful setting, ideal for relaxation. It is accessible by car via a dirt road, and while the beach itself is secluded, nearby areas offer attractions like hiking trails and scenic views.
The proximity to the port of Santa Cruz de La Palma offers additional sightseeing opportunities, making the area appealing for both beachgoers and nature lovers.
